#1b5bde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b5bde is composed of 10.6% red, 35.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 59%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 220.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 48.8%. #1b5bde color hex could be obtained by blending #36b6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1b5bde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b5bde has RGB values of R:27, G:91,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1792990.

Shades and Tints of #1b5bde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050c is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b5bde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7c7e is the less saturated color, while #0854f1 is the most saturated one.
